How to hire a personal trainer pro in Philippines
- Decide between gym-attached PT (Anytime, Fitness First — sold as packages on top of membership) and cheaper freelance coaches
- Ask freelancers for their certification lineage (ACE, NASM, FILBEX or gym-academy training) — there's no licensing, so credentials vary widely
- Confirm first aid/CPR training — insurance is rare among freelancers, so gym-based sessions carry the gym's cover
- If training in a condo or village gym, confirm admin/HOA allows outside coaches
- Book a trial session before buying a package
- Agree payment per session or small packages first — avoid large prepayments to independents
No licensing exists for trainers in the Philippines. Big chains sell PT bundled with membership at premium rates; freelance coaches are far cheaper but vet certifications and first-aid training yourself, since liability insurance is uncommon.

Frequently asked questions
Is it cheaper to train at a gym or have a trainer come to me?
Gym-based sessions are usually the cheapest because the facility is included. Mobile trainers add a travel premium of roughly 10-25%, but you save the gym membership and commute, so total cost can even out if you don't otherwise use a gym.
How many sessions a week do I actually need?
Two to three sessions a week is the sweet spot for most strength or fat-loss goals. On a tight budget, one supervised session a week plus a written program you follow on your own days delivers most of the benefit at a third of the cost.
What happens at the first personal training session?
Expect a health questionnaire (PAR-Q), a movement and fitness assessment, and goal-setting — not a punishing workout. Many trainers discount or waive the first session; use it to judge coaching style before buying a package.
Can I split personal training sessions with a friend?
Yes — semi-private (2:1) training typically costs each person 60-70% of the solo rate, so the trainer earns slightly more per hour while you both save. It works best when you and your partner have similar fitness levels and goals.
Is online personal training worth it compared to in-person?
Online coaching (programmed workouts plus weekly check-ins) runs 30-50% cheaper than in-person sessions. It suits self-motivated people with some lifting experience; beginners usually get better value from in-person sessions where form gets corrected in real time.
How much does a personal trainer cost in the Philippines?
Freelance coaches typically charge PHP 500-1,500 per session; PT packages at major chains like Fitness First run higher, often PHP 1,500-2,500 per session bundled in blocks. Provincial rates sit well below Metro Manila.
Gym PT package or freelance coach — which is better value in the Philippines?
Freelance is usually half the price for comparable coaching if you already have gym access or a condo gym. Chain packages make sense when you want the facility, insurance cover and structured progress tracking in one bill.
